Background and Aim of 8J1MORSE:
8J1MORSE is a special memorial station that commemorates the 220th anniversary of the birth of Samuel Morse and the first successful Morse Code communication across the Atlantic Ocean by Guglielmo Marconi in 1901.
With the advancement of radio communication technologies, the Morse Code is placed at the brink of extinction as the modern technology continues to replace the traditional arts of communication. This year, practical Morse Code examinations for amateur radio licenses will be abolished in Japan, as well as in other countries. As the Morse Code technique threatens to disappear even amongst the amateurs, we feel it very important to preserve the Morse Code technique as a thriving and valid means of communication. Contribute to this movement to preserve the art of the Morse Code! Just jump into the Morse Code world; you are always welcome! Let us make sure that the Morse Code never disappears amongst us amateurs.

2. QRV Schedules:
Members of A1 Club Japan will operate 8J1MORSE from 1st June to 30th November 2011 with supports of JARL and CQ Publishing Co.,Ltd.
8J1MORSE will be on the air from different JA callsign districts (maximum ten districts; JA0 to JA9). So, you will find "8J1MORSE/2", "8J1MORSE/3", etc.

4. QSL:
We will send our QSLs via BURO for all QSOs without exception. So, if you are not in a hurry, please just wait until the QSL is sent to you via BURO in your entity. If you have a QSL manager, please kindly write to "8j1morse.qsl(at)gmail.com" soon after you contact with 8J1MORSE, and tell us to whom our QSL should be addressed. Otherwise, our QSL will go to your own callsign.
We are NOT a user of either LoTW or eQSL. However, unfortunately, many DX news websites all over the world have been providing the incorrect, unreliable and confusing information about this matter. Please note that this official website is everything.
If you have a question about QSL, please do not hesitate to contact us. Send your e-mail to "8j1morse.qsl(at)gmail.com".

5. Awards:
We will issue the following awards. Your application will be always welcome and greatly appreciated.

(I) General informations of award application:
Award application is free of charge. QSL is unnecessary to apply for the awards, as far as your QSO data are confirmed by our log. Application form should be sent to "8j1morse.award(at)gmail.com" by e-mail. As soon as your application is approved, the award (either a JPG or PDF file) will be sent to you by e-mail.
If you know someone who is interested in applying for our awards, but has no internet facility, please kindly give him a hand. You can send us his application form instead of him.
